MVL, which stands for Mobility Value Lab, is an innovative project that combines the fields of mobility and blockchain technology. The primary goal of MVL is to share data value among all participants in its ecosystem. This integration is accomplished using various blockchain protocols that are designed to enhance the development of mobility services.

It offers a wide range of financial services, including lending, borrowing, automated market making (AMM), and asset management. Developed by Scallop Labs, which has a team of experts in DeFi, cybersecurity, and fintech, Scallop has attracted support from notable investors such as CMS Holdings, 6th Man Ventures, KuCoin Labs, and Mysten Labs. Additionally, it is the first DeFi project to receive an official grant from the Sui Foundation, highlighting its institutional-grade quality and strong security features.
